"Halekulani Okinawa exceeded every expectation and was easily the most luxurious resort we experienced during our time in Japan. Traveling as a family of four, we chose to splurge on two rooms in the Sunset Beach Tower, and it was absolutely worth it.
The rooms were stunning, thoughtfully designed, and fully equipped with premium amenities. From the stocked minibar and Nespresso machine to the beach bag and sandals you can take home, every detail felt elevated. The inclusion of comfortable pajamas added an extra layer of comfort. Housekeeping was exceptional with daily service and a relaxing evening turndown.
Service across the entire resort was outstanding. Every staff member we encountered was warm, attentive, and genuinely eager to help, creating a welcoming and seamless experience throughout our stay.
Dining was a highlight. We enjoyed dinners at House Without a Key, which offered a perfect casual setting with great seafood, pasta, and salads, and Steak & Wine for a more upscale experience. The quality of food was excellent across the board. Steak & Wine is on the pricier side, but the experience and quality matched the cost. Be sure to book reservations in advance as slots open daily and fill quickly.
We chose to explore local cafés for breakfast, which was a great way to experience the island. The resort is also conveniently located near several excellent dining options.
The gym was well-equipped, and the pool areas were beautiful and relaxing. 5 Stars all the way!!"
"Older hotel, but beautiful. It’s not easy to get to from the airport if you are taking a taxi or limo bus. Takes about 2 hours with traffic. Multiple restaurants, but there is usually long lines for the buffets. Absolutely gorgeous ocean views. Only two out of three elevators were working and we were on the 9th floor, so on average it took between 5-10 minutes of waiting during busy times to get on an elevator. Most times we were crammed in like sardines and stopped at every floor.
Property is walkable and there are hidden little beaches everywhere. You can rent an e-bike and ride around. We rode to the lighthouse and into town. The staff were excellent and the rooms were huge. Only a few restaurants were open in March. I guess more open up over the summer, but finding options were limited. There is a little town square about a 12 minute walk from the hotel that has more dining options. "
